Please help me extend a warm NJFishing.com welcome to the Hurd Family and crew of the party boat Miss Avalon www.missavalon.com

They fish daily from April - December from 8am to 3pm for Blackfish, Fluke, Seabass, Stripers and Porgies and are set up with double anchors for bottom fishing.

No reservations required

The Miss is Avalon is a 78 foot luxury fishing yacht powered by NEW, super-clean, twin diesels! They have the latest safety and fish finding equipment, a clean galley with tables and chairs and seating for 32, along with the cleanest restrooms on the ocean.

The Hurd family has been fishing for 70 years. Captain Irv Hurd is the 3rd generation captain in the family to skipper the Miss Avalon. He earned his captain’s license in 1981. His grandfather (captain Irv Hurd Sr.) started the Miss Avalon fishing business in 1952, retiring in 1972 after which Captain Uncle Jerry skippered the Miss Avalon until 2012 and was succeeded by Captain Irv in 2013. Captain Brandon Hurd earned his 100 ton masters license in 2016 and became the 4th generation skipper in the Hurd family.

I’ve been fishing with the Hurds for 30 years.
Come see them in South Jersey.
The boat is minutes from Exit 13 on the Parkway.
Tons of easy free parking.
There’s a deli and bait shop at the dock (Moran’s Dockside).
And a Wawa on the way to the boat.
Always a great attitude.
Always a great crew.
They bend rods all summer with triggerfish and flounders on 4 hour trips.
But the Miss Avalom really has the blackfish dialed in every spring and fall.
Capt. Irv hangs two anchors every drop every trip.
He has hundreds of spots within 45 minutes from the dock.
